Multi-Hop Routing

Algorithm

Multi-Hop Routing, within cryptocurrency and derivatives markets, represents a packet-switching technique adapted for decentralized networks, optimizing transaction relay across multiple nodes to circumvent direct peer limitations. Its implementation aims to enhance privacy by obscuring the origin and destination of transactions, a critical feature for sensitive financial operations and regulatory compliance. This routing strategy is particularly relevant in blockchain environments where transaction fees are variable and network congestion impacts execution speed, offering a potential pathway for cost-effective and timely settlement. Consequently, the efficiency of this algorithm is directly correlated to the network’s topology and the incentive mechanisms governing node participation.
